# Operational Enterprise AI

Build credibility by showing what the system does, where it stops, who approves actions, and how failures recover.

## Establish the Story

1. Open with the operational problem and one restrained product image or system trace.
2. Use a white interlude to quantify the problem with verified metrics.
3. Explain each capability as a workflow with permissions and controls.
4. Address security, governance, exceptions, and rollback before the conversion ask.
5. Move from verified case-study evidence into a qualified demo or waitlist handoff.

Replace source brands, customers, numbers, security badges, screenshots, and claims. Do not invent compliance or performance evidence.

## Build the Visual System

- Use near-black, warm white, muted gray, and one restrained spectral treatment.
- Pair a high-x-height sans-serif with compact mono labels and tabular numerals.
- Use hard grid lines, square media, low radii, and minimal shadow.
- Keep data legibility ahead of atmosphere.
- Reserve white chapters for operational explanation and metric pauses.
- Avoid glowing AI orbs, particle fields, neon gradients, and generic cyber-security imagery.

## Compose the Page

- Header: show product, solutions, security, case studies, and one qualified action.
- Hero: state the system boundary and pair it with one deliberate operational visual.
- Metrics: use only verified numbers with scope, source, and timeframe.
- Solution rows: summarize workflow, permissions, action, approval, output, audit, exception, and rollback.
- Product demo: show real or clearly labeled sample data and deterministic state changes.
- Security: connect controls to concrete risks; do not use unsupported badges.
- Case studies: separate verified implementation facts from marketing interpretation.
- Testimonials: use grayscale portrait evidence only when licensed and real.
- FAQ: resolve ownership, data handling, integrations, review, failure, and procurement questions.
- Final CTA: qualify who the product is for and explain what happens after submission.

## Implement Operational Solution Rows

- Keep summary, permissions, action, approval, output, audit, exception, and rollback in a stable data model.
- Use semantic disclosure with equivalent hover and focus cues.
- Support Enter and Space expansion and keep text equivalents for diagrams.
- Design loading, unavailable integration, insufficient permission, stale data, denied approval, partial completion, rollback, and error states.
- Keep the buyer able to evaluate scope and risk without animation.

## Implement the Case-Study Handoff

- Connect each verified use case to the relevant demo or waitlist context.
- Preserve attribution and separate facts, quotes, and inferred outcomes.
- Prefill only non-sensitive intent data and only with consent.
- Design filters, links, form fields, loading, disabled, duplicate, validation, network error, and success states.
- Explain who receives the request, expected response, and data use.

## Motion Defaults

- Use 160–220ms for controls and 500–760ms for section entrances.
- Favor slow background media, precise metric reveals, and restrained row transitions.
- Use hard black-to-white handoffs instead of gratuitous smooth scrolling.
- Keep parallax below 5%, pause offscreen work, and clean up observers.
- Render settled states immediately under reduced motion.

## Validate

- Review every metric, case study, quote, badge, and compliance statement against evidence.
- Test solution rows, filters, forms, errors, focus return, and browser history with keyboard and touch.
- Verify diagram text alternatives, contrast, 200% zoom, mobile order, loading, stale data, and reduced motion.
- Confirm the visitor can state what the product controls, what requires approval, and how rollback works.
- Remove unsupported security, availability, performance, accessibility, or compliance claims.

## Avoid

- Magical automation claims with no permissions or exception model.
- Fake dashboards, metrics, customers, badges, or case-study outcomes.
- Glowing AI orbs, particle clouds, and cyberpunk decoration.
- A generic sales leap from feature list to contact form.
- Hiding risk, audit, failure, or rollback details behind vague copy.
